This README covers only the firmware side of the Tumblecrate laundry-locker system. The access flow itself — how a resident's short-lived unlock token is minted, how the locker controller validates it offline, and how revocation propagates after a lost-phone report — is documented separately. Security reviewers should pay particular attention to the token replay window and the fallback PIN path, since both have been flagged in prior audits. The threat model, sequence diagrams, and audit history are maintained on the internal page.

runbook for tafof-yawif: https://confluence.tolvaqsys.internal/display/display/browse/pages/7be3

## Gatekeeper: Rate Limiting Data Store

Quick heads-up for reviewers: the Gatekeeper gateway tracks per-client token buckets in a small Postgres instance, not Redis like the old Fencepost service did. Each request decrements a counter row; a sweeper job refills buckets every 500ms. Yes, it's chatty, but it survived the Larkmoor load test fine. If you're poking at the bucket tables or the sweeper locks, connect using the connection string below.

replica DSN, yahaf-yagaf: mongodb://tamath_svc:a2netSk3RZMuTj@db-d084.novacsoft.internal:5432/ralmir

Fan-out backpressure for the Quillet notifier: when the queue depth crosses the soft limit, the dispatcher sheds low-priority pushes and batches the rest at 500ms intervals. Reviewer should confirm the shed counter is exported and that retries respect the jitter window. Once merged, the release artifact gets re-signed by the pipeline, which expects the deploy key shown below.

deploy key for bawep-yawif: bky6_GQhaSt

Subject: Quickstore 4.2 — bloom filter now fronts the KV layer

Plugin authors: starting with this release, Quickstore places a bloom filter ahead of the key-value store. Negative lookups return faster; false positives fall through safely. No API changes are required on your side. Verify your plugin against the staging build referenced below.

session token of fahif-tadup = htk3_9c7